Postdoctoral Scholar (SERB N-PDF), Research Summary

The use of native and engineered enzymes for biocatalytic applications holds great potential for the green synthesis of several platform chemicals and pharmaceutical intermediates. My project focuses on the development of multifunctional nitrilase biocatalysts for the hydrolysis of nitrile substrates to commercially and pharmaceutically important carboxylic acid precursors. The work involves i) genome mining for novel nitrilases and activity screening on a broad substrate panel, ii) enhanced enzyme production using high cell density fermentation process iii) characterization and engineering of nitrilases for enhanced activity or substrate tolerance, and iv) development of efficient biotransformation processes for nitrile conversion. We also work on other industrially important biotransformation using alcohol dehydrogenases, formate dehydrogenases and transaminases.
